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,323,722,296
Lastest Block:
1,960,241
Utxos:
1,983,746
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
07/02/2021 09:36:00 UTC
Txid
763e92121feb3357575b9d5a2ac46595e82a2d08807bcb20c7dd6f8cc9b649d6
Block
45,882
Block hash
49fe01026939e536a1dc4dc2f104eff6e964e5fd8dfc78f13431d8187fc845fe
Stake amount
2,062.76730191 XEP
Sender
ep1qpgwyl8epzyfvwte79l2akn8cghmp6kfeuus0v9
Recipient
ep1qpgwyl8epzyfvwte79l2akn8cghmp6kfeuus0v9
(28,991,764.76730191 XEP)